Revolutionizing Learning and Training in Healthcare: Tracing AI Videos from Text in Hospitals
In today's rapidly evolving healthcare industry, continuous learning and training are crucial for healthcare professionals to stay updated with the latest advancements and provide high-quality care to patients. Traditionally, learning and training in healthcare have relied heavily on textbooks, lectures, and hands-on experience. However, with the advent of artificial intelligence (AI), there is a revolutionary opportunity to enhance the learning and training experience through AI-generated videos.
AI-powered technology has made significant advancements in natural language processing (NLP) and computer vision, paving the way for creating interactive and engaging learning content. By leveraging these capabilities, AI can convert text-based medical information into immersive and visually appealing videos that enable healthcare professionals to better understand complex concepts, procedures, and techniques.
One of the primary advantages of AI-generated learning videos is their ability to simplify complex medical jargon and present it in a digestible format. Medical textbooks are often dense and overwhelming, making it challenging for learners to grasp intricate details. However, AI can convert these texts into visually stimulating videos that break down complex concepts into easily understandable visual representations. This not only enhances comprehension but also increases retention, ensuring that healthcare professionals can recall and apply their knowledge effectively in real-life scenarios.
Moreover, AI-generated videos can provide an interactive learning experience by incorporating elements such as quizzes, simulations, and virtual scenarios. These features allow healthcare professionals to actively participate in the learning process, reinforcing their understanding and decision-making skills. For instance, AI can simulate realistic patient scenarios in the videos, allowing learners to practice making diagnoses, interpreting lab results, or performing procedures virtually. By immersing themselves in these interactive learning experiences, healthcare professionals can gain practical skills and confidence before encountering similar situations in real-world settings.
Another significant advantage of AI-generated videos is their ability to adapt to individual learning styles and pace. Every learner has unique preferences and needs, and traditional learning methods may not cater to everyone's requirements. AI can personalize learning content by analyzing individual progress, strengths, and weaknesses, and tailoring the video content accordingly. For example, if a healthcare professional struggles with a particular topic, AI can provide additional explanations, examples, or supplementary materials to ensure comprehensive understanding. This adaptive learning approach optimizes the learning process, making it more effective and efficient.
Furthermore, AI-generated videos can be updated in real-time, ensuring that healthcare professionals have access to the most up-to-date information. In healthcare, new discoveries, treatments, and guidelines are constantly emerging, and it is crucial for professionals to stay informed. With AI, learning materials can be automatically updated based on the latest research and developments, eliminating the need for manual revisions or outdated resources. This real-time updating feature enables healthcare professionals to stay at the forefront of medical knowledge and provide the best possible care to their patients.
While AI-generated videos have immense potential in revolutionizing learning and training in healthcare, it is essential to acknowledge that they are not meant to replace traditional learning methods entirely. Instead, AI should be seen as a powerful tool that complements and enhances existing educational approaches. The combination of AI-generated videos with hands-on experience, clinical rotations, and mentorship can create a well-rounded and comprehensive learning environment for healthcare professionals.
